90210 Zip Code Mystery: What Makes It So Famous
The ZIP code 90210 location refers to Beverly Hills, California, a globally recognized city within Los Angeles County known for luxury retail, celebrity residences, and high-end tourism. Assigned by the U.S. Postal Service, 90210 primarily covers central Beverly Hills, including Rodeo Drive and surrounding residential neighborhoods, making it one of the most iconic postal codes in the United States.
Geographic Scope and Postal Boundaries
The postal code area of 90210 is situated in Southern California and encompasses the heart of Beverly Hills, bordered by Los Angeles neighborhoods such as West Hollywood and Holmby Hills. While many assume it covers all of Beverly Hills, the city is also served by ZIP codes 90211 and 90212, with 90210 specifically covering the northern and central sections.
According to U.S. Postal Service data updated in 2024, the ZIP code population for 90210 is estimated at around 21,000 residents, though daytime population swells significantly due to tourism and retail activity. The area spans approximately 5.7 square miles, making it relatively compact but densely associated with wealth and cultural influence.

Why 90210 Became a Cultural Symbol
The cultural significance of 90210 skyrocketed in the 1990s due to the television series "Beverly Hills, 90210," which aired from October 4, 1990, to May 17, 2000. The show attracted over 10 million viewers weekly at its peak, embedding the ZIP code into global pop culture as a symbol of wealth, youth, and glamour.
Beyond television, the luxury branding identity of 90210 has been reinforced by decades of celebrity residency and high-end commerce. Real estate listings in this ZIP code frequently exceed $5 million, with some properties surpassing $50 million, according to 2025 market reports from Zillow and Redfin.

Economic Impact on Shopping and Tourism
The retail tourism hub of 90210 draws millions of visitors annually, particularly to Rodeo Drive, which hosts flagship stores for brands like Chanel, Gucci, and Louis Vuitton. The Beverly Hills Conference & Visitors Bureau reported over 7.5 million visitors in 2024, with shopping accounting for nearly 40% of tourist spending.
The hospitality sector growth in 90210 includes luxury hotels such as The Beverly Hills Hotel and Waldorf Astoria Beverly Hills. Average nightly rates in this ZIP code exceeded $850 in 2025, reflecting its premium positioning in global tourism markets.

How ZIP Codes Like 90210 Are Assigned
The ZIP code system was introduced by the United States Postal Service in 1963 to improve mail sorting efficiency. Each code is structured so that the first digit represents a group of U.S. states, while subsequent digits narrow down the delivery area.
- The first digit "9" indicates the Pacific region.
- The next two digits "02" identify the sectional center facility in Los Angeles.
- The final two digits "10" specify the local delivery area within Beverly Hills.
This postal routing logic ensures efficient mail distribution but has also unintentionally created branding power for certain ZIP codes like 90210.
Real Estate and Demographics
The housing market profile of 90210 is dominated by luxury single-family homes, gated estates, and upscale condominiums. Census data and private market analyses indicate that over 60% of properties are owner-occupied, with a median household income exceeding $180,000 annually.
The demographic composition includes a mix of long-term residents, international buyers, and high-profile individuals. Approximately 28% of residents are foreign-born, contributing to a cosmopolitan cultural environment.
